1. Double-Check the Delivery Details
Before jumping to conclusions, revisit the delivery confirmation email or the tracking information on Amazon’s website. Ensure that the package was indeed sent to your correct address. Sometimes, a simple typo or an incorrect address can lead to confusion. If the address is correct, proceed to the next step.
2. Search Your Property Thoroughly
Delivery drivers often leave packages in inconspicuous places to protect them from theft or weather. Check around your porch, garage, side gates, or even under doormats. If you live in an apartment complex, inquire with your building manager or neighbors, as packages are sometimes left in common areas.
3. Check with Household Members or Neighbors
It’s possible that someone in your household or a neighbor accepted the package on your behalf. Ask around to see if anyone has seen or collected it. Neighbors, especially in close-knit communities, often help out by holding onto packages for safekeeping.
4. Review Security Cameras or Doorbell Footage
If you have a security camera or a smart doorbell, review the footage to confirm whether the package was delivered. This can provide valuable evidence if the package was misdelivered or stolen.
5. Wait a Little Longer
Sometimes, packages are marked as “delivered” prematurely by the carrier. Give it a few hours or even a day. In rare cases, the package might still be in transit and will arrive shortly after the status update.
6. Contact Amazon Customer Service
If the package hasn’t shown up after a reasonable wait, reach out to Amazon’s customer service. They can investigate the issue further, contact the carrier, or initiate a replacement or refund if necessary. Be prepared to provide your order number and any relevant details.
7. File a Claim with the Carrier
If Amazon’s investigation doesn’t resolve the issue, you can file a claim directly with the delivery carrier (e.g., UPS, FedEx, USPS). Provide them with the tracking number and any evidence you have, such as security footage or photos of your property.
8. Report Potential Theft
If you suspect your package was stolen, report the incident to your local authorities. While they may not always be able to recover the package, filing a report can help track patterns of theft in your area.
9. Consider Preventative Measures
To avoid future issues, consider using Amazon Locker for secure package pickup, requiring a signature for delivery, or installing a secure package drop box at your home.

Q: What should I do if the carrier claims the package was delivered, but I didn’t receive it?
A: Contact Amazon customer service immediately. They can work with the carrier to investigate and resolve the issue.
Q: Can I get a refund if my package is marked as delivered but not received?
A: Yes, Amazon typically offers refunds or replacements for packages that are confirmed as lost or stolen.
Q: How long should I wait before reporting a missing package?
A: Wait at least 24-48 hours after the delivery confirmation before reporting the issue, as the package may still arrive.
Q: What if the package was delivered to the wrong address?
A: If the carrier confirms misdelivery, they may attempt to retrieve the package. If unsuccessful, Amazon will usually send a replacement.
